    In the paper today...

    Turns out that there is photo radar in this zone. There were reports the driver was headed home from an overnight shift and the coroner investigating the incident says it's possible the truck was on cruise control when the accident occurred. They state, it has to be asked if the use of cruise control diminished the concentration of the driver. The driver was in his lane, travelling at normal speed. The day was grey and wet and a bit hazy, which did not help visibility.
